Rock fishing is Australia's most dangerous recreational sport.
磯釣是澳洲最危險 的休閒運動。
Since 2004, more than 170 anglers have lost their lives on NSW rock platforms. Almost all were not wearing a lifejacket. The ocean does not give second chances — gear up, plan your fish, and respect the wash.
Good preparation starts before the berley bucket: choose a safe fishing platform first, then prepare and deploy your burley responsibly. Our forecasts support trip planning, but they do not replace checking live conditions on the day, official warnings, or your own judgement.

Rock fishing safety is never about wave height alone — four factors must be judged together: tide, swell height, swell period, and wind & swell direction.
磯釣安全不能只看浪高,而是要同時判斷四個因素:潮水、湧浪高度、浪週期、風向與浪向。
1. Tide
1. 潮水
The tide is the change in sea level over the day.
潮水是海面高度的變化。
Rising tide — rock gradually covered, waves reach the platform more easily, risk increases.漲潮——礁石逐漸被海水覆蓋,海浪更容易打上平台,危險增加。
Falling tide — more rock exposed, usually safer, but still watch the swell and wave sets.退潮——礁石露出較多,通常較安全,但仍須注意湧浪與浪組。
Many accidents happen on the way up to high tide, not at high tide itself.
很多意外都發生在漲潮途中,而不是滿潮。
2. Swell Height
2. 湧浪高度
Swell is generated by distant storms and travels hundreds or thousands of kilometres.
湧浪是由遠方風暴形成,傳播數百甚至數千公里而來的海浪。
0.8 m — usually settled.0.8 m → 通常較平穩。
1.5 m — raise your guard.1.5 m → 已需提高警覺。
2.5 m+ — most rock platforms are already very dangerous.2.5 m↑ → 多數磯場已非常危險。
The higher the swell, the greater the energy.
浪越高,能量越大。
3. Swell Period
3. 浪週期
Period (seconds) is the time between two wave crests. Most people only read swell height and ignore period — but at the same height, a longer period carries far more energy.
1.5 m @ 7 s — lower energy, short choppy waves.1.5 m @ 7 秒——能量較小,浪較短、較碎。
1.5 m @ 15 s — much more energy, pushes far further up the rock, far more likely to produce a sneaker wave.1.5 m @ 15 秒——能量大幅增加,浪推得更遠,更容易衝上礁石,更容易出現「瘋狗浪(Sneaker Wave)」。
6–8 s — short period, low energy.6–8 秒——短週期,能量較低。
9–11 s — medium period, start paying attention.9–11 秒——中等週期,開始需要注意。
12–14 s — long period; dangerous even when the height looks small.12–14 秒——長週期,即使浪高不大,也可能非常危險。
15 s+ — very long period, high alert. Many rock accidents happen in these conditions.15 秒以上——非常長週期,高度警戒,許多岩礁事故都發生在這類海況。
NRFSA reminder: "1.5 m @ 16 s" often deserves more caution than "2.0 m @ 8 s".
NRFSA 提醒:「1.5 m @ 16 秒」往往比「2.0 m @ 8 秒」更值得提高警覺。

Wave reach = tide + swell height + run-up, and run-up grows with period. A 1.5 m swell at 15 s on a high tide can reach further up a 3 m ledge than a 2.5 m swell at 7 s.浪到達的高度 = 潮高 + 浪高 + 爬升;週期越長,爬升越高。滿潮時 1.5 米、15 秒的長浪, 可能比 2.5 米、7 秒的短浪爬得更上 3 米高的磯台。

4. Wind & Swell Direction
4. 風向與浪向
Wind direction is where the wind blows from; swell direction is where the waves come from. Together they decide how the sea behaves at your ledge.
風向是風從哪裡吹來;浪向是海浪從哪裡過來。兩者一起決定釣點海面的真實狀況。
Onshore wind — messier seas, waves pushed harder onto the shore.迎岸風(Onshore)——海浪更亂,更容易把浪推向岸邊。
Offshore wind — the surface may look flat, but that does not mean safe: the swell underneath can still be huge.離岸風(Offshore)——海面可能較平,但不代表安全,湧浪仍可能非常巨大。
If your ledge faces straight into the swell, waves hit the rock directly.如果你的釣點正對浪向,海浪會直接衝擊礁石。
Headlands, islands or coastline can shelter a spot, so the same swell height can feel completely different.岬角、島嶼或海岸地形可以遮蔽釣點,即使同樣浪高,實際海況可能完全不同。
Read the tide — know whether the water will cover your ledge.看潮,知道海水會不會淹上來。
Read the swell — know how big the waves are.看浪,知道海浪有多高。
Read the period — know how much energy those waves carry.看週期,知道海浪有多大的能量。
Read wind and swell direction — know whether the sea will get worse and whether the swell hits your spot head-on.看風向與浪向,知道海面會否惡化,以及浪會不會直接打向你的釣位。
NRFSA reminder: there is no absolutely safe number. What matters is reading tide, swell height, period, and wind & swell direction together, then combining that with what you actually see on the ledge before you make a decision.
